I rode Pine Hill for the first time today - there are some sweet trails there and Mike Smith and his crew just keep building more. Mike and his crew were out there today building an amazing articulated bridge on Stegosaurus and they built a full-bore suspension bridge on Overlook that's just astounding.

Weather was OK, the Pine Hill trails are steep enough to drain well. The terrain's a little like some of the stuff in Massachusetts - lots of rocks - but there are few in the trails due to massive labor input. Halfpipe reminds me a little of Sidewinder, same idea.
